The ODC Plug Male to ODC Plug Male Fiber Cable is a pre-terminated outdoor fiber optic cable designed for reliable optical connectivity in harsh environmental conditions. It features duplex single mode G657A2 fibers with a compact 5.0mm non-armored TPU outer jacket, providing excellent flexibility, mechanical protection, and resistance to outdoor elements. Both ends are equipped with ODC male connectors for quick and secure installation without field splicing.

Designed for fiber-to-the-antenna (FTTA), wireless communication, and outdoor network applications, this cable provides stable low-loss transmission and long-term durability. The G657A2 bend-insensitive fiber ensures improved installation flexibility, making it suitable for applications where cable routing space is limited or frequent bending is required.

What is the advantage of using G657A2 fiber in this cable?

G657A2 fiber is a bend-insensitive single mode fiber designed to maintain low optical loss even when installed with tighter bends. It is especially suitable for FTTA and outdoor applications where cable routing space is limited.

What is the difference between TPU and traditional fiber cable jackets?

TPU jackets provide better mechanical strength, flexibility, abrasion resistance, and environmental protection compared with many standard jacket materials. They are commonly used for outdoor fiber assemblies exposed to movement, vibration, or harsh installation conditions.

Is this cable suitable for 5G base station applications?

Yes. The ODC Plug Male to ODC Plug Male cable is commonly used in FTTA systems for connecting remote radio units (RRUs) and antenna equipment in 4G/5G wireless networks.

Does the cable require field termination during installation?

No. This cable is factory pre-terminated with ODC male connectors on both ends, allowing direct connection to compatible equipment and reducing installation time and termination errors.
